www.gsyw.net > rAphAEl.js

rAphAEl.js

raphael-svg-import 据说这个可以 https://github.com/wout/raphael-svg-import jQuery(document).ready(function(){ jQuery.ajax({ type: "GET", url: "assets/demo.svg", dataType: "xml", success: function(svgXML) { var paper = Raphael(1...

没有学过该库。不过可以猜想一下,基于js的话,js中绘图是基于canvas元素的。而canvas中的话,path方法估计就是基于这个: beginPath();lineTo(坐标)closePath().具体的话,可以参看w3c的教程中有关canvas部分。

text用textarea(用CSS3控制),不需要用SVG里面的text rect也完全可以用div代替。 如果非要用svg,可以把有相同的变换的图形,放在组合里(svg中的g元素) 这样能精简很多操作。

1.屏蔽这个行JS,看看还有错吗? 2.试试替换最新版本,MSDN上找了个(不确定是不最新),你也可以试试找找。 (function(b){function d(a){this.input=a;a.attr("type")=="password"&&this.handlePassword();b(a[0].form).submit(function(){if(a...

Raphael在初始化画布的时候就允许你填入参数来规定画布大小啊 var paper = Raphael(10, 50, 320, 200);x:10,y:50,宽320,高200 不知道你指的svg是这个不?

把事件触发改成click

rapheal.js,是一个轻量级的脚本库,它兼容了VML和SVG,从而可以适应任何的浏览器。但正因为是其很好的兼容性,导致其无法很方便地实现画箭头的操作。因为在SVG里面,画箭头和VML完全不同。所以,你想想看,它要做到兼容,势必在这一点上就肯定...

window.Raphael.svg && function (m) {}(window.Raphael); 这是个表达式 如果window.Raphael.svg和 window.Raphael 都存在 那么就返回true了 如果window.Raphael.svg 和 window.Raphael 只存在一个有值 那么false 如果window.Raphael.svg 和 win...

var paper =...

网站地图

All rights reserved Powered by www.gsyw.net

copyright ©right 2010-2021。
www.gsyw.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com